
Excel中一拖到最后一行的方法有多种:利用快捷键、使用拖动手柄、利用名称框。 其中,利用快捷键是最为高效和精准的方法。通过按下Ctrl + Shift + 向下箭头键,你可以迅速选中当前数据区域中的所有单元格,不需要手动拖动鼠标。接下来,我们将详细讨论这些方法,并提供一些额外的技巧和注意事项,以确保你能够在各种场景下顺利完成任务。
一、利用快捷键
快捷键是Excel中最方便和高效的功能之一,尤其是在处理大量数据时。
1. 基本操作
按下 Ctrl + Shift + 向下箭头键 是最常见的方法。这种方法可以让你迅速选中当前数据区域中的所有单元格,而不需要手动拖动鼠标。
2. 应用场景
这种快捷键特别适用于数据密集型的工作表。如果你需要处理成千上万行的数据,手动拖动将非常耗时且容易出错。
3. 组合使用
你还可以结合其他快捷键来进行更复杂的操作。例如,按下 Ctrl + Shift + 向右箭头键 可以选中一行中的所有单元格,与向下箭头键结合使用可以选中整个数据块。
二、使用拖动手柄
拖动手柄是Excel中一个非常直观的功能,但在处理大量数据时可能不太实用。
1. 基本操作
将鼠标悬停在单元格右下角的小方块上,光标会变成一个黑色的十字。按住鼠标左键并拖动到你想要的行。
2. 应用场景
这种方法适用于小规模的数据处理。如果你的数据集比较小,拖动手柄可以非常方便地选中多个单元格。
3. 注意事项
在处理大量数据时,拖动手柄可能不够精确,而且容易导致误操作。例如,你可能会不小心拖动到其他列或行,影响数据的完整性。
三、利用名称框
名称框是Excel中一个非常有用但常常被忽略的功能。它可以帮助你快速导航到工作表中的任何位置。
1. 基本操作
在名称框中输入你想要选中的范围,例如"A1:A1048576",然后按下回车键。这将选中从第一个单元格到最后一个单元格的所有行。
2. 应用场景
这种方法特别适用于你已经知道具体范围的情况。它可以确保你选中的范围非常精确,而不需要手动拖动或使用快捷键。
3. 组合使用
你还可以结合其他功能来进行更复杂的操作。例如,你可以在名称框中输入公式或引用其他工作表中的数据,以便更灵活地处理数据。
四、使用VBA代码
如果你需要经常进行大量的数据处理,编写VBA代码可能是一个非常高效的解决方案。
1. 基本操作
打开VBA编辑器,输入以下代码:
Sub SelectToEnd()
Range("A1", Range("A1").End(xlDown)).Select
End Sub
运行这个宏将会选中从单元格A1开始到数据区域的最后一个单元格。
2. 应用场景
这种方法特别适用于需要定期处理大量数据的工作。如果你经常需要选中大范围的单元格,编写一个宏可以显著提高效率。
3. 组合使用
你还可以编写更复杂的VBA代码,以便处理更复杂的任务。例如,你可以结合其他Excel函数来动态生成选中范围,或者根据特定条件进行筛选和处理。
五、利用表格功能
Excel中的表格功能可以自动扩展和选中数据区域,非常适合处理动态数据。
1. 基本操作
将你的数据转换为表格(按下Ctrl + T),然后点击表格右下角的小箭头,将其拖动到你想要的行。
2. 应用场景
这种方法特别适用于需要频繁更新的数据集。表格功能可以自动扩展和缩小数据范围,使得你的数据处理更加灵活和高效。
3. 注意事项
使用表格功能时,确保你的数据没有空行或空列,这可能会导致表格功能无法正常工作。
六、利用数据筛选
数据筛选功能可以帮助你快速选中特定条件下的数据,非常适合处理复杂的数据集。
1. 基本操作
在数据选项卡中,点击筛选按钮,然后根据需要选择筛选条件。选中筛选后的数据,可以按下Ctrl + Shift + 向下箭头键进行快速选中。
2. 应用场景
这种方法特别适用于需要根据特定条件处理数据的情况。例如,你可以筛选出所有销售额超过特定数值的记录,然后进行进一步的处理。
3. 组合使用
你还可以结合其他功能来进行更复杂的操作。例如,你可以先使用筛选功能选中特定条件下的数据,然后结合VBA代码或其他快捷键进行进一步的处理。
七、利用Excel函数
Excel中的一些函数也可以帮助你快速选中和处理数据。
1. 基本操作
使用函数如INDEX、MATCH和OFFSET,可以帮助你动态生成选中范围。例如,你可以使用以下公式生成一个动态范围:
=OFFSET(A1, 0, 0, COUNTA(A:A), 1)
2. 应用场景
这种方法特别适用于需要动态处理数据的情况。例如,你可以根据数据的变化自动调整选中范围,而不需要手动干预。
3. 注意事项
使用函数时,确保你的数据没有空行或空列,这可能会导致函数返回错误的结果。
八、利用第三方插件
有许多第三方插件可以帮助你更高效地处理Excel中的数据。这些插件通常提供更强大的功能和更友好的界面。
1. 基本操作
安装并启动插件,根据插件提供的功能进行操作。例如,一些插件提供一键选中所有数据的功能,极大地简化了操作步骤。
2. 应用场景
这种方法特别适用于需要处理非常复杂的Excel任务。例如,一些插件可以提供高级的数据分析和处理功能,使得你的工作更加高效。
3. 注意事项
在使用第三方插件时,确保插件的来源可靠,并且与Excel版本兼容。某些插件可能会影响Excel的稳定性或导致数据丢失。
九、利用数据透视表
数据透视表是Excel中一个非常强大的数据分析工具,可以帮助你快速选中和处理大量数据。
1. 基本操作
创建一个数据透视表,并根据需要设置行和列标签。你可以通过拖动字段来调整数据透视表的结构,从而选中特定范围的数据。
2. 应用场景
这种方法特别适用于需要进行复杂数据分析的情况。例如,你可以根据特定条件进行数据分组和汇总,然后选中汇总结果进行进一步处理。
3. 组合使用
你还可以结合其他Excel功能来进行更复杂的操作。例如,你可以先创建一个数据透视表,然后结合筛选功能和快捷键进行进一步的处理。
十、利用Power Query
Power Query是Excel中的一个强大的数据导入和处理工具,可以帮助你快速选中和处理大量数据。
1. 基本操作
通过Power Query导入数据,并根据需要进行数据清洗和转换。你可以使用Power Query的各种功能来过滤、排序和合并数据,然后将结果导出到Excel中进行进一步处理。
2. 应用场景
这种方法特别适用于需要处理复杂数据源的情况。例如,你可以从多个文件或数据库中导入数据,然后使用Power Query进行数据转换和清洗。
3. 组合使用
你还可以结合其他Excel功能来进行更复杂的操作。例如,你可以先使用Power Query导入和转换数据,然后结合数据透视表和快捷键进行进一步的分析和处理。
通过这些方法和技巧,你可以更高效地在Excel中选中和处理大量数据。无论你的数据处理需求有多复杂,Excel都提供了丰富的功能和工具来帮助你完成任务。希望这些内容对你有所帮助,提升你的工作效率。
相关问答FAQs:
1. 如何在Excel中将数据一次性拖到最后一行?
- 找到你想要拖动的数据所在的单元格。
- 将鼠标悬停在选中的单元格的右下角,鼠标会变成一个加号形状的十字箭头。
- 按住鼠标左键并向下拖动,直到拖动到最后一行的目标位置。
- 松开鼠标左键,数据将被拖动到最后一行。
2. 如何在Excel中将公式一拖到最后一行?
- 在公式输入框中输入你想要拖动的公式。
- 按下Enter键,确保公式正确计算。
- 将鼠标悬停在公式输入框的右下角,鼠标会变成一个加号形状的十字箭头。
- 按住鼠标左键并向下拖动,直到拖动到最后一行的目标位置。
- 松开鼠标左键,公式将被拖动到最后一行,并自动适应每一行的数据。
3. 如何在Excel中将格式一拖到最后一行?
- 选中一个包含你想要拖动的格式的单元格。
- 将鼠标悬停在选中的单元格的右下角,鼠标会变成一个加号形状的十字箭头。
- 按住鼠标左键并向下拖动,直到拖动到最后一行的目标位置。
- 松开鼠标左键,格式将被拖动到最后一行,并自动应用于每一行的数据。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4370858